#CED042 Hex color

#CED042

The hexadecimal color code #CED042 corresponds to the code RGB( 206, 208, 66 ). It's a shade of Yellow. This color is a combination of red (at 0,81 level), green (at 0,82 level) and blue (at 0,26 level). Its brightness is 53% and its saturation is 60%. It is composed of red at 42%, green at 43% and blue at 13%.

Color Palettes

The complementary color #312FBD is the color exactly opposite to #CED042 on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.

Uses of #CED042 in CSS

When using #CED042 as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#CED042 as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
